/ 雑記帳

Audacious 設定

ヤマハの古いサウンドカードの対応....

ALSA2



— posted by くま at 09:52 pm   pingTrackBack [0]

 

mpd Yamaha DS-1S YMF744

# yum install kmod-alsa-1.0.24-2.el6.elrepo.i686
      
audio_output {
type "jack"
name "my jack device"
}

audio_output {
type "alsa"
name "My ALSA Device"
# device "hw:0,0" # USB Audio
# device "hw:0,1" # M-AUDIO - Audiophile 192
device "iec958:CARD=YMF744,DEV=0" # Yamaha DS-1S YMF744
# device "iec958:CARD=M2496,DEV=0" # M-AUDIO - Audiophile2496
mixer_type "software"
mixer_control "PCM" # optional
# mixer_index "0" # optional
}

DCIM0040



— posted by くま at 07:15 pm   pingTrackBack [0]

rpm を使いこなす道具_3

一つのディレクトリーにソースと成果をまとめられる。
#!/bin/sh

echo "-----------------------------------"
ls *.src.rpm
echo "-----------------------------------"
echo ""
echo "Build file_name"
echo ""
read file1
echo ""
##########
echo "rpm 格納 Dir name?"
echo ""
read dir1
mkdir $dir1
##########
echo ""
#rpmbuild --rebuild --ba $file1 | tee build.log
rpmbuild --rebuild --ba --define="__check_files %{nil}" $file1 | tee build.log
echo "-----------------------------------"
#######echo "sakura" | sed -e "s|sakura|$HOME|"
plce=`pwd`
echo "$plce"
echo ""
grep "書き込み完了" build.log | ¥
sed 's/書き込み完了:/mv /g' | ¥
sed "s|$| $plce|g" | ¥
sed "s|$|¥/|g" | ¥
sed "s|$|$dir1|g" | ¥
sed "s|$|¥/|g" > move_rpm.sh
echo "-----------------------------------"
cat move_rpm.sh
echo "-----------------------------------"
chmod +x move_rpm.sh
./move_rpm.sh
mv $file1 $dir1/
echo "-----------------------------------"
ls -lrt $dir1/
echo "-----------------------------------"

— posted by くま at 08:29 am   pingTrackBack [0]

 

rpm を使いこなす道具_2

# vi .bashrc
       
----省略----
alias rrb='rpmbuild --rebuild'
alias pacoinstall='paco -lD make install'
alias yump='yum provides'
alias yumie=' yum install --enablerepo'
alias yumue=' yum update --enablerepo'

— posted by くま at 08:21 am   pingTrackBack [0]

 

rpm を使いこなす道具_1

このスクリプトを使うとインストールしたパッケージを検索し易い。
       
#!/bin/csh

set list1=$PWD/centos`uname -r`-`date +%Y-%m-%d`.lst
#
if ( -e $list1 ) then
echo "リストが存在、続行します。"
else
case2:
echo "####################"
echo "# リスト作成中.... #"
echo "####################"
rpm -qa --last > $list1
endif
echo ""
#
case1:
echo ""
echo "このリストで良いですか?"
echo "*************************************************"
head $list1
echo "*************************************************"
echo ""
echo "y or n ?"
set yn = $<
if ( "$yn" == n ) then
rm -i $list1
goto case2
else
#exit
#endif
echo ""
echo "What rpm-Packege-name Key-Word"
echo ""
set key = $<
echo ""
echo "*************************************************"
grep $key $list1 | sort
echo "**************************************************"
echo ""
#
echo ""
echo "続けますか?"
echo "y or n ?"
set yn = $<
if ( "$yn" == y ) then
goto case1
else
exit
endif

— posted by くま at 08:14 am   pingTrackBack [0]

レジューム付きでコピー

rsync -av -e ssh --progress --partial --append 226.48.255.251:/home/hoge/linux.ova ./

— posted by くま at 09:52 pm   pingTrackBack [0]

 

これが再現できない...

https://www.youtube.com/watch?v=ainjV3X6wqQ

— posted by くま at 02:30 pm   pingTrackBack [0]

 

CentOS6 ハードディスク UUID 確認

# rpm -ivh vol_id-085-30.10.i586.rpm
準備中... ########################################### [100%]
1:vol_id ########################################### [100%]
$ df
Filesystem 1K-blocks Used Available Use% Mounted on
/dev/sdb2 76625608 8870644 63862852 13% /
tmpfs 969012 240 968772 1% /dev/shm
/dev/sdb1 297485 62847 219278 23% /boot
/dev/sda1 480720592 151285628 305015688 34% /var/video
/dev/sr0 210640 210640 0 100% /media/virt-p2v-0.9.9
# vol_id
usage: vol_id [--export|-t|-l|-u]
--export
-t filesystem type
-l filesystem label
-u filesystem uuid
    
# vol_id /dev/sdb2
ID_FS_USAGE=filesystem
ID_FS_TYPE=ext3
ID_FS_VERSION=1.0
ID_FS_UUID=4868943e-52ed-4449-a15b-d890768a7499
ID_FS_LABEL=
ID_FS_LABEL_SAFE=

— posted by くま at 02:05 pm   pingTrackBack [0]

CentOS6.5

このサーバーをCentOS6.5へ

desktop



— posted by くま at 07:46 am   pingTrackBack [0]

 

/etc/crontab うまく動作しないのでいじってみた

# yum -y install cronie-noanacron
# yum -y remove cronie-anacron
# vi /etc/crontab
     
# run-parts
01 * * * * root run-parts /etc/cron.hourly
42 7 * * * root run-parts /etc/cron.daily
44 7 * * 0 root run-parts /etc/cron.weekly
45 7 1 * * root run-parts /etc/cron.monthly
25 22 * * * root /root/clamav.sh
     
$ cat /etc/cron.d/dailyjobs
SHELL=/bin/bash
PATH=/sbin:/bin:/usr/sbin:/usr/bin
MAILTO=root
HOME=/
     
# run-parts
25 7 * * * root [ ! -f /etc/cron.hourly/0anacron ] && run-parts /etc/cron.daily
05 6 * * 0 root [ ! -f /etc/cron.hourly/0anacron ] && run-parts /etc/cron.weekly
20 6 1 * * root [ ! -f /etc/cron.hourly/0anacron ] && run-parts /etc/cron.monthl
     
参考:http://t0463.blogspot.jp/2013/03/centos60crontab.html

— posted by くま at 07:34 am   pingTrackBack [0]

<< 2024.9 >>
SMTWTFS
1234 5 6 7
89 101112 1314
15 161718192021
222324 25262728
2930     
 
























T: Y: ALL: Online:
ThemePanel
Created in 0.0605 sec.